THE HUMAN FIGURE IN MOTION

This project is a recreation and an updating of A Study In Human Motion originally created in 1896. The purpose of the project was to study the human figure in motion. This is an ongoing project that we have been working on for many years. It is a very serious and intense project for artists and art students. Please email with questions or further information.

Back then it was considered mostly a scientific study as well as an art study. Today the use will be for artists, art teachers and animators to study human motion in detail.
